Bus line 25 runs from El Perelló to Gavines, covering key areas like the City of Arts and Sciences and the southern beaches. A great option for reaching cultural spots and neighborhoods like Montolivet, with stops near historic churches and convenient transfers to other EMT lines.
Line 25 runs from El Perelló to Gavines - Entrada a la Baixada del Pantà, making 55 stops along its route across Valencia.

First and last bus and frequency of line 25 by day type, from EMT's official GTFS feed.
| Day | Frequency | First | Last |
|---|---|---|---|
| Weekday | 15–20 min | 06:20 | 02:30 |
| Saturday | 15–20 min | 06:20 | 02:30 |
| Sunday & holidays | 15–20 min | 06:20 | 01:35 |
Approximate frequency from EMT's official GTFS feed; actual service may vary on holidays. Data valid Jul 24, 2026–Aug 30, 2026.

Line 25 has 55 stops, between El Perelló and Gavines - Entrada a la Baixada del Pantà. You can see them all in order above and on the map.
Line 25 crosses Pobles del Sud, Ciutat de les Arts i de les Ciències, Montolivet, Complejo Playas de Civisa.
At its stops you can connect with EMT lines 4, 10, 12, 13, 23, 24, 35, 94, 95.
Yes. The whole EMT fleet is accessible by municipal bylaw: line 25 buses carry a double ramp (electric and manual) at the middle door and two anchored wheelchair spaces. If the ramp fails, the vehicle is replaced with an adapted one.
On weekdays line 25 runs about every 15-20 minutes, with the first service at 06:20 and the last at 02:30.
